Fruit and Cheese Braid With Chocolate Sauce
- Ready In:
- 40mins
- Ingredients:
- 10
- Yields:
-
12 slices
ingredients
- 1 (3 ounce) package cream cheese
- 1⁄4 cup butter or 1/4 cup margarine
- 2 1⁄2 cups Bisquick baking mix
- 1⁄2 cup orange juice (any flavor fruit juice)
- 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
- 1⁄4 cup orange marmalade (any flavor fruit preserves)
-
Chocolate Drizzle Sauce
- 1⁄2 cup powdered sugar
- 2 tablespoons cocoa
- 1⁄4 teaspoon vanilla
- 3 -4 teaspoons milk
directions
- Heat oven to 400°F Cut 3 ounces cream cheese and butter into baking mix. Stir in fruit juice (orange).
- Turn dough out onto surface well dusted with baking mix. Gently roll in baking mix to coat. Knead 10 times. Roll into rectangle 15 X 9 inches. Place on large ungreased cookie sheet.
- Beat 8 ounces cream cheese and fruit preserves (marmalade) until smooth. Spread mixture in a 4 inch strip lengthwise down center of dough rectangle.
- Cut dough into strips stopping at the cream cheese layer (do not cut all the way through).
- Fold strips over filing overlapping and crossing at center (to create a braid).
- Bake 20 minutes or until golden. While braid is baking, mix all chocolate sauce ingredients until smooth.
- Once done, cool 10 minutes and remove to wire rack. Cool completely and drizzle with chocolate sauce.
